diff options
Diffstat (limited to 'src/libs/modelinglib/qmt/style/styledrelation.h')
-rw-r--r-- | src/libs/modelinglib/qmt/style/styledrelation.h | 6 |
1 files changed, 5 insertions, 1 deletions
diff --git a/src/libs/modelinglib/qmt/style/styledrelation.h b/src/libs/modelinglib/qmt/style/styledrelation.h index 422947908e..27e8735463 100644 --- a/src/libs/modelinglib/qmt/style/styledrelation.h +++ b/src/libs/modelinglib/qmt/style/styledrelation.h @@ -9,21 +9,25 @@ namespace qmt { class DRelation; class DObject; +class CustomRelation; class QMT_EXPORT StyledRelation { public: - StyledRelation(const DRelation *relation, const DObject *endA, const DObject *endB); + StyledRelation(const DRelation *relation, const DObject *endA, const DObject *endB, + const CustomRelation *customRelation); ~StyledRelation(); const DRelation *relation() const { return m_relation; } const DObject *endA() const { return m_endA; } const DObject *endB() const { return m_endB; } + const CustomRelation *customRelation() const { return m_customRelation; } private: const DRelation *m_relation = nullptr; const DObject *m_endA = nullptr; const DObject *m_endB = nullptr; + const CustomRelation *m_customRelation = nullptr; }; } // namespace qmt |